Burnout stems from prolonged stress and the weight of multiple roles. Women are more prone to burnout than men due to societal expectations and the demands of managing both careers and personal lives. This can result in anxiety, depression, and physical health issues like fatigue, cardiovascular strain, and hormonal imbalances.

​

Thriving begins with balance. Self-care is a critical first step, taking time to recharge through mindfulness, creative pursuits, or simple moments of quiet reflection helps restore energy. Setting boundaries is equally essential; learning to say no and protecting personal time prevents overcommitment and fosters mental clarity. Regular physical activity, whether it’s a brisk walk or yoga session, not only enhances physical health but also boosts mood and reduces stress. Building support networks with friends, mentors, or professionals provides emotional resilience and practical assistance when life feels overwhelming.
